u-boot-brain/arch/arm
Breno Lima e11b49c8d8 imx: hab: Check if IVT header is HABv4
The HABv4 implementation in ROM checks if HAB major version
in IVT header is 4.x.

The current implementation in hab.c code is only validating
HAB v4.0 and HAB v4.1 and may be incompatible with newer
HABv4 versions.

Modify verify_ivt_header() function to align with HABv4
implementation in ROM code.

Signed-off-by: Breno Lima <breno.lima@nxp.com>
Reviewed-by: Ye Li <ye.li@nxp.com>
Signed-off-by: Peng Fan <peng.fan@nxp.com>
2021-04-27 15:13:57 -03:00
..
cpu configs: fsl: move bootrom specific defines to Kconfig 2021-03-05 10:25:41 +05:30
dts imx8mn: Add LPDDR4 EVK board support 2021-04-27 15:13:57 -03:00
include imx: hab: Check if IVT header is HABv4 2021-04-27 15:13:57 -03:00
lib Merge branch '2021-02-02-drop-asm_global_data-when-unused' 2021-02-15 10:16:45 -05:00
mach-aspeed common: Drop asm/global_data.h from common header 2021-02-02 15:33:42 -05:00
mach-at91 common: Drop asm/global_data.h from common header 2021-02-02 15:33:42 -05:00
mach-bcm283x common: Drop asm/global_data.h from common header 2021-02-02 15:33:42 -05:00
mach-bcmstb
mach-cortina
mach-davinci common: Drop asm/global_data.h from common header 2021-02-02 15:33:42 -05:00
mach-exynos common: Drop asm/global_data.h from common header 2021-02-02 15:33:42 -05:00
mach-highbank
mach-imx imx: hab: Check if IVT header is HABv4 2021-04-27 15:13:57 -03:00
mach-integrator
mach-ipq40xx
mach-k3 common: Drop asm/global_data.h from common header 2021-02-02 15:33:42 -05:00
mach-keystone dm: i2c: use CONFIG_IS_ENABLED macro for DM_I2C/DM_I2C_GPIO 2021-02-21 06:08:00 +01:00
mach-kirkwood dm: i2c: use CONFIG_IS_ENABLED macro for DM_I2C/DM_I2C_GPIO 2021-02-21 06:08:00 +01:00
mach-lpc32xx
mach-mediatek common: Drop asm/global_data.h from common header 2021-02-02 15:33:42 -05:00
mach-meson ARM: mach-meson: select MMC_PWRSEQ config 2021-02-19 15:11:21 +08:00
mach-mvebu arm: mvebu: a38x: Remove dead code ARMADA_39X 2021-03-12 07:44:21 +01:00
mach-nexell common: Drop asm/global_data.h from common header 2021-02-02 15:33:42 -05:00
mach-octeontx common: Drop asm/global_data.h from common header 2021-02-02 15:33:42 -05:00
mach-octeontx2 common: Drop asm/global_data.h from common header 2021-02-02 15:33:42 -05:00
mach-omap2 arm: omap3: Compile s_init() function only when it is used 2021-03-03 04:12:46 +01:00
mach-orion5x common: Drop asm/global_data.h from common header 2021-02-02 15:33:42 -05:00
mach-owl common: Drop asm/global_data.h from common header 2021-02-02 15:33:42 -05:00
mach-qemu
mach-rmobile Merge branch '2021-02-02-drop-asm_global_data-when-unused' 2021-02-15 10:16:45 -05:00
mach-rockchip Merge branch '2021-02-02-drop-asm_global_data-when-unused' 2021-02-15 10:16:45 -05:00
mach-s5pc1xx
mach-snapdragon common: Drop asm/global_data.h from common header 2021-02-02 15:33:42 -05:00
mach-socfpga arm: socfpga: Only do 'is OS booted from FIT' checking when VAB is enabled 2021-03-23 14:46:35 +08:00
mach-sti
mach-stm32
mach-stm32mp arm: stm32mp: Fix compilation issue when SYS_DCACHE_OFF and/or SYS_DCACHE_SYS are enabled 2021-03-12 10:58:55 +01:00
mach-sunxi dm: i2c: use CONFIG_IS_ENABLED macro for DM_I2C/DM_I2C_GPIO 2021-02-21 06:08:00 +01:00
mach-tegra common: Drop asm/global_data.h from common header 2021-02-02 15:33:42 -05:00
mach-u8500 common: Drop init.h from common header 2020-05-18 17:33:33 -04:00
mach-uniphier common: Drop asm/global_data.h from common header 2021-02-02 15:33:42 -05:00
mach-versal common: Drop asm/global_data.h from common header 2021-02-02 15:33:42 -05:00
mach-versatile
mach-zynq common: Drop asm/global_data.h from common header 2021-02-02 15:33:42 -05:00
mach-zynqmp Xilinx changes for v2021.04-rc3 2021-02-23 10:45:55 -05:00
mach-zynqmp-r5 common: Drop asm/global_data.h from common header 2021-02-02 15:33:42 -05:00
thumb1/include/asm/proc-armv
config.mk
Kconfig arm: socfpga: Move Stratix10 and Agilex to use TARGET_SOCFPGA_SOC64 2021-03-08 10:59:10 +08:00
Kconfig.debug
Makefile